The job holder plays an important role in the Technical Support team by providing daily technical support to distributors and sub-distributors, including troubleshooting, technical training, product induction, and promotion. The job holder is expected to ensure satisfactory HIKVISION technical services and continuous optimization of HIKVISION products via collation of customers’ requirements or product quality issues and giving prompt feedback.

  • Deal with technical issues that are raised by distributors and sub-distributors.
  • Sort out cases in relation to product problems and carry out internal case-sharing.
  • Provide Hikvision Software/Hardware training on operation, installation, commissioning, and maintenance to distributors and sub-distributors.
  • Summarise product requirements in the regions, analyse and give feedback to the R&D team of headquarters, promote optimization and upgrading of products, and ensure regional market needs are met.
  • Collate product quality issues and give prompt feedback; escalate the issues to the Technical Support or R&D team of headquarters in a timely manner to improve the quality of products.
  • Provide promotion of new products to distributors and sub-distributors via training, roadshows, exhibitions, exhibition receptions, etc.
  • Provide product consultation and product selection service to distributors and sub-distributors.
  • Carry out other duties assigned by the line manager.

Knowledge Skills

  • Fluent in Microsoft Office applications including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Fluent in English and Mandarin, both written and verbal.
  • Good communication skills and interpersonal skills.
  • Network/IT basic knowledge.
  • From an Engineering or related degree discipline.

Competence

  • Ability to convey complex technologies and specifications.
  • Aptitude to quickly learn new technologies.
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Detail-oriented troubleshooting skills.
  • High flexibility to work onsite or in the office and ready to travel on short notice.
  • An ability to work with diverse teams and team members (Product, Channel sales, etc.).
